The General Tax Authority (GTA) has announced the opening of the “Tabadol” portal for submitting Country-by-Country Reporting (CbCR) for the fiscal year 2024, as well as the notifications for the fiscal year 2025, with a deadline of December 31, 2025. This initiative targets taxpayers, accounting firms, and auditors, enabling the relevant authorities to gain a comprehensive and accurate view of the activities of multinational companies.
The “Tabadol” portal is an electronic platform dedicated to exchange tax information with relevant authorities in partner jurisdictions, in line with international agreements. The GTA clarified that multinational companies headquartered in Qatar with total revenues of QAR 3 billion or more during the reported fiscal year are required to submit these reports and notifications. All targeted taxpayers are urged to comply with the deadlines and to use the portal to submit accurate information in a timely manner.
The GTA emphasized that the purpose of these reports is to enhance trust and cooperation between countries in the field of taxation, improving law enforcement, and reducing the risk of double taxation, thereby contributing to a transparent and stable investment environment.
